In context — 2 Kings 22:17
Because they have forsaken Me and burned incense to other gods to provoke Me by every deed of their hands, My wrath has ignited against this place and will never be extinguished.
About this coordinate
2 Kings 22:17:14 is a BCV:P reference — Book · Chapter · Verse · Word Position. It addresses word 14 of 2 Kings 22:17, so the Hebrew word בַּמָּק֥וֹם (bamakom) can be cited, linked and studied at exactly this position rather than somewhere in the verse. In the Biblical Knowledge Coordinate System the same position is written 2 Kgs.22.17.W14, which extends further down to each syllable (2 Kgs.22.17.W14.S1) and character.
